Synonyms of hard line

Noun


1. hard line, position, stance, posture

usage: a firm and uncompromising stance or position; "the governor took a hard line on drugs"

Adjective


1. hard-line, hardline, uncompromising (vs. compromising), sturdy, inflexible

usage: firm and uncompromising; "a hard-line policy"
